龙蜥OS(Anolis OS)与 CentOS 在系统更新策略和支持周期上存在显著差异,主要源于二者定位、治理模式和演进路径的根本不同。以下是关键对比:
| 维度 | 龙蜥OS(Anolis OS) | CentOS(历史版本 vs. 当前 CentOS Stream) |
|---|---|---|
| 项目性质与定位 | 由开放原子开源基金会孵化、阿里云牵头主导的独立国产开源 Linux 发行版,面向云原生、AI、数据库等企业级场景,强调自主可控与创新迭代。 | • 传统 CentOS(≤8):RHEL 的下游免费重建版,纯稳定分发,无自主开发。 • 当前 CentOS Stream(自2021年起):RHEL 的上游开发流(rolling preview),是 RHEL 的“预发布”测试分支,非稳定生产发行版。 |
| 更新模式 | ✅ 双轨并行更新: • 稳定版(LTS):每2年发布一个主版本(如 Anolis 8、Anolis 23),提供长达10年的全生命周期支持(含安全更新、关键补丁、内核热补丁); • 滚动更新版(如 Anolis Rolling):面向开发者/前沿技术用户,提供较新的内核、工具链和云原生组件(如 eBPF、io_uring、新GPU驱动),更新频繁(月度/季度)。 |
❌ CentOS Stream ≠ 稳定版: • 持续集成式滚动更新(每日/每周合入 RHEL 开发变更),无固定版本号,稳定性低于 RHEL,需自行承担兼容性风险; • 不提供长期稳定版本,也不再有类似 CentOS 7/8 的传统 LTS 分发。 |
| 支持周期(LTS 版本) | 🔹 Anolis 8(基于 RHEL 8 兼容): • 发布于 2021 年,支持至 2031 年(10 年) • 提供内核热补丁(无需重启修复高危漏洞)、国密算法、龙芯/鲲鹏/飞腾等多架构原生支持。 🔹 Anolis 23(基于 RHEL 9 兼容 + 自主增强): |
⚠️ CentOS Stream 不承诺固定支持周期: • 生命周期与对应 RHEL 主版本强绑定(如 Stream 9 跟随 RHEL 9,预计支持至 ~2027–2028),但官方未明确声明 LTS 期限; • 无 10 年支持保障,且因是开发流,可能提前终止对旧 Stream 分支的支持; • 传统 CentOS 7 支持已于 2024-06-30 正式结束,CentOS 8 已于 2021-12-31 提前终止(远短于原计划)。 |
| 补丁与安全更新 | ✅ 主动维护 + 快速响应: • 安全漏洞(CVSS ≥ 7.0)通常在 72 小时内发布修复(含热补丁); • 自建 CVE 响应中心,支持国密 SM2/SM3/SM4、可信计算等合规特性; • 提供 anolis-upgrade 工具支持跨大版本平滑升级(如 8→23)。 |
⚠️ 依赖 Red Hat 开发节奏: • 安全补丁随 RHEL 开发流程同步进入 Stream,无 SLA 承诺,延迟不可控; • 不提供热补丁(kpatch/kgraft),关键修复常需重启; • 无针对中国合规场景(如等保、密评)的定制化加固。 |
| 社区与治理 | 🌐 开放中立的基金会项目(开放原子开源基金会): • 多家厂商(华为、Intel、腾讯、中科方德等)共建,代码、决策、路线图全部开源透明; • 技术委员会(TC)民主治理,版本规划公开可查(https://openanolis.cn)。 |
🏢 Red Hat 单一主导: • CentOS Stream 本质是 Red Hat 控制的 RHEL 开发管道,社区无版本决策权; • 路线图与发布时间由 Red Hat 内部决定,透明度有限。 |
✅ 总结关键差异:
- 稳定性 vs. 前沿性:龙蜥OS LTS 版本追求企业级长期稳定+自主可控;CentOS Stream 是RHEL 的上游实验场,适合参与 RHEL 开发而非生产部署。
- 支持承诺:龙蜥OS 明确提供 10 年 LTS 支持(含热补丁、多架构、国密),而 CentOS Stream 无长期支持承诺,且已终结传统 CentOS 模式。
- 适用场景:
→ 选 龙蜥OS:政企信创、X_X核心系统、云平台底座、需要 10 年稳定保障及国产化适配(LoongArch/ARM64/RISC-V);
→ 慎选 CentOS Stream:仅推荐 RHEL 生态开发者、ISV 测试环境或愿意承担滚动更新风险的非关键业务。
💡 建议:若原使用 CentOS 7/8 迁移,龙蜥OS 是官方推荐的平滑替代方案(兼容 RPM 包、YUM/DNF 工具链),并提供一键迁移工具
centos2anolis。
如需具体版本升级路径或硬件兼容性清单,可进一步提供需求,我可为您细化。
云小栈